Q: What is the main role of Irrigation filter factory in agricultural systems? A: Irrigation filter factory is responsible for manufacturing filtration units that remove debris and particles from irrigation water, ensuring that pipes and emitters remain unclogged. This contributes to the consistent delivery of water to crops and improves irrigation efficiency. Q: What types of irrigation filters are commonly produced by Irrigation filter factory? A: Irrigation filter factory typically manufactures screen filters, disc filters, and media filters. Each type is designed for specific water quality conditions, flow capacities, and levels of particulate contamination, offering flexibility across agricultural applications. Q: How do filters produced by Irrigation filter factory support drip irrigation systems? A: Filters from Irrigation filter factory are essential in drip irrigation, where even tiny clogs can affect performance. The filters trap sediments, algae, and organic matter before water enters the tubing, ensuring uniform water distribution to every plant. Q: Are the filters from Irrigation filter factory suitable for automated systems? A: Yes, many filters manufactured by Irrigation filter factory are compatible with automatic backflush systems. These filters can self-clean at set pressure intervals, reducing manual labor and ensuring uninterrupted operation in large-scale farms. Q: What factors influence the design of filters at Irrigation filter factory? A: The design depends on water source, desired filtration level, system pressure, and maintenance preferences. Irrigation filter factory considers these variables to produce filters that match regional agricultural demands and varying irrigation techniques.
